Case Analysis of Seismic Evaluation of Existing Nuclear Facilities
Earthquake is one of the main external risk factors for nuclear power. Especially after the March 11 earthquake in Japan, the Fukushima nuclear power accident has attracted worldwide attention. The seismic margin of existing nuclear facilities in all countries has been evaluated. However, the seismic margin assessment is mainly aimed at the situation beyond the design basis. For some existing nuclear facilities, there are changes in the seismic fortification criterion. At this time, it is necessary to conduct seismic appraisal. For the seismic appraisal of civil buildings, countries all over the world have formed relatively perfect technical standards, but there is no mature and general method for the seismic appraisal of existing nuclear facilities. When seismic identification of existing nuclear facilities is carried out, simple calculations based solely on the original design method are unreasonable. There is a need to propose a reasonable specialized method for seismic identification. Through the seismic evaluation of an existing nuclear facility, this paper puts forward the key technical problems to be considered in the research of seismic evaluation method of existing nuclear facilities. It provides a reference for the establishment of seismic evaluation method of existing nuclear facilities.
